HR Manager-Consulting Summary:
The HR Manager/Business Partner will be responsible for developing a deep understanding of the business and assigned functional groups' current and future strategy plans and objectives. This role will be accountable for leading initiatives to directly impact strategies to foster talent development, performance management, compensation, D&I, and workforce planning. The HR Manager will collaborate with business leaders, as well as other business advisors (e.g. Talent Acquisition, Learning & Professional Development, Finance, etc.), on talent-related matters and will act as an employee and firm advocate and change agent.
Essential Duties
Talent Strategy & Execution
- Responsible for relationship management with functional business leaders to ensure day-to-day operations function consistently and in alignment with firm strategy e.g. talent/client experience, employee engagement, retention & culture/diversity/inclusion and recognition initiatives.
- Build strong relationships with business leaders across the firm, considering talent trends, business needs, business direction and business strategy in order to deliver solutions that support positive results and impact firm performance
- In partnership with COE's, HR Market & line of business peers, seek to find increased efficiencies while maintaining quality client service
- Lead the delivery of RSM's Talent strategy in alignment with firm strategy, to drive consistency across a matrixed organization
- Integrate, align, and embed culture of diversity and inclusion in activities and initiatives
Talent Management
- Coach leaders and help develop plans for career growth, leadership opportunities, mobility, and succession
- Leverage existing reports (recognition, feedback) to gather, organize data, conduct basic analysis, and develop conclusions.
Employee Relations & Compliance
- Coach and advise employees and leaders on challenging and complex situations by applying comprehensive knowledge of HR and firm policies and procedures
- Provide coaching to people leaders on complex performance issues, including collaboration on employee counseling reports (ECR)
- Partner with employee relations team regarding investigations and difficult employee matters
Performance Management & Salary Administration
- Educate and advise local leadership on compensation objectives, bonus programs, and applicable regulations.
- Facilitate talent development meetings including year-end performance, promotion, and compensation recommendations
People Leadership
- Coach, mentor, and develop other HR team members in the role as a Career Advisor and/or informal reporting relationships; set appropriate performance expectations and provide feedback.
- Other duties as assigned
